By Josh on 11/16/10 00:00 AM (PST)
Vehicle
2001 Chevrolet Silverado 1500 4dr Extended Cab LS 4WD SB (4.8L 8cyl 4A)
Review
I bought this truck in 2006 with 59,000 miles on it and now it has 108,000 and it runs like it did when I bought it. I now have flowmaster exhaust on it and that gave me noticeably better gas mileage. The best mileage I have gotten is 22 doing 70. I get about 13 to 15 in town. Does great on the highway and handles like car. It has plenty of power! It has always started in the cold, even 20 below zero in Montana where I live. Does well in every road condition you drive on. Very smooth suspension as well.

By Former Chevyman on 09/28/10 00:00 AM (PDT)
Vehicle
2001 Chevrolet Silverado 1500 4dr Extended Cab 4WD SB (4.8L 8cyl 4A)
Review
Camshaft and lifter failure at 71K! Pitted cam lobe evident once exposed along with a worn valve lifter. Was diligently maintained including oil changes, routine servicing, etc. Independent repair shop says defective parts were installed at manufacture. Took 70K miles to manifest itself hence the time bomb. GM says off warranty so no help or assistance possible with $4500 repair costs. Also a front shimmy since it was new has been troublesome and apparently is not fixable per Chevy, Les Schwab Tires, and independent repair shop. CD player failed at 45K miles, never bothered to repair. Third new Chevy truck I have owned and it's definitely the last.
